My teenage self still sings the opening line in the shower like it’s a spell. To me, the meaning of 'Let It Go' is this messy, beautiful shove toward being unapologetically yourself. The lyrics trace Elsa’s shift from hiding—'conceal, don’t feel'—to smashing that glass ceiling she built around her emotions. Snow and ice become more than spectacle; they’re armor, art, and an honest reflection of the distance she’s felt from the world. Singing it at full volume in a lonely car once felt like ripping off a mask after a bad day, and that catharsis is exactly what the song sells: release followed by acceptance.

There’s also a darker, quieter side I catch now that I’m older. Some lines read like a surrender to isolation, a choice to cut ties rather than heal them. But the more generous take is that Elsa chooses authenticity over safety, decides to own what was always hers. The songwriting—cleverly simple, emotionally escalating—lets kids feel empowered while giving adults layers to unpack: trauma, guilt, liberation, and the fear of hurting others when you change. Whether you see it as rebellion or rebirth, 'Let It Go' resonates because it names the craving we all have: to stop pretending and start living a version of ourselves that’s honest, even if it’s messy and loud. I still get chills when the chorus lifts, and that’s enough to keep me singing it on bad days.

I love how 'Let It Go' works as a tiny pop-opera about choosing freedom. When I listen, I don’t hear just a catchy chorus; I hear someone deciding to stop policing herself for other people’s comfort. The progression in the lyrics mirrors the musical build: quiet restraint in the verses, then the break and declaration in the chorus. That structural push makes the emotional shift feel earned, not accidental.

On another level, the song is a brilliant cultural mirror. Kids latch onto the obvious empowerment anthem—be yourself, even if others don’t get it—while adults pick up the subtext about consequences and responsibility. The line 'The cold never bothered me anyway' works like a shrug and a shield simultaneously: it can be prideful or defensive, depending on what your life has taught you. Personally, I use the song when I need a confidence boost before something nerve-wracking; it’s like wearing armor that sparkles. If you haven’t, try watching 'Frozen' with the subtitles on and pay attention to the small lyric choices—they shift your sympathy and show how compact storytelling in a song can be unforgettable.

I usually blast 'Let It Go' while cleaning or jogging, and it’s wild how different moods change what the lyrics mean to me. On upbeat days it’s pure empowerment—saying goodbye to expectations and finally living loud. On quieter nights it feels more like a confession, a recognition that hiding was a slow, heavy thing to carry. Elsa’s snowfall imagery reads as both a protective blanket and a prison, which is what makes the song stick: it doesn’t hand you a single truth. The chorus—especially 'let it go'—acts like a mantra you can use for so many tiny dramas: a bad breakup, a dreaded apology you can’t take back, a job you hate. Musically it’s simple but massive, and that combo lets listeners project their own stories into the space. I think that’s why people keep singing it years later; it’s a soundtrack for starting over, or at least for trying to, and that possibility feels useful and dangerous at the same time.
